So first, me improved and redesigned the known design flaws and added mainly two construction changes, which were pointed to be weak points and its become much stiffer! Decided also to replace gripper with suction unit incl. pressure sensor. The new robot design shall become a pick and place machine of plastics discs on turntable for ultrasonic welding as main application purpose as seen in animation I made see in video shot below and next I will describe here will be code porting from porcessing to python enviroment. My aim is a real usefull purpose described above so here 3D Simulation of the matter / aim in Solidworks2020 (welding machine is not on the picture, I dont own one. To make it presision machine, I plan to add a Computer vision with Python language and therefore want port the code from Processing / Arduino to python / Arduino code

Next I created a GUI - graphical user interface in Python and its Tkinter internal module, picture below, and further plan is to code the rest in Python in order to order commands after pressing these buttons on GUI, which will send string arrays via serial to Arduino, to drive the robot
